XLiteLLM: A Lightweight Wrapper for LLM API Calls

XLiteLLM is a Python library designed to simplify interaction with Large Language Models (LLMs). It provides both synchronous and asynchronous interfaces for making requests to LLMs, with built-in support for retries, JSON response handling, and logging. XLiteLLM supports passing user and system prompts, optional images, and various configuration options for controlling model behavior.

Features

  • Synchronous and Asynchronous API Calls: Support for both blocking and non-blocking interaction with LLMs.
  • Flexible Prompt Construction: Combine user and system prompts, with optional image inputs.
  • JSON Response Processing: Easily extract structured data from model responses.
  • Retry Mechanism: Automatically retry failed requests up to a configurable limit.
  • Configurable Parameters: Customize model settings such as temperature, token limits, and timeout.
  • Logging Integration: Built-in logging for monitoring requests, responses, and errors.

Installation

Requirements

  • Python 3.11 or higher

Setup

pip install xlitellm

Configuration

Before running the example scripts, you need to provide values for the required environment variables. Use the .env.example file in the examples/ directory as a starting point:

.env.example:

LOG_LEVEL=
MISTRAL_API_KEY=
OPENAI_API_KEY=
GEMINI_API_KEY=
ANTHROPIC_API_KEY=
GROQ_API_KEY=
  1. Duplicate the .env.example file and rename it to .env:

    cp examples/.env.example examples/.env
    
  2. Populate the .env file with appropriate values for your environment.

Usage

Core Functions

call_llm

Synchronous function for making LLM API calls.

  • Parameters:

    • user_prompt (str): The user's input prompt.
    • system_prompt (str): Optional system message to guide the LLM's behavior.
    • images (list[str], optional): List of image URLs or base64 strings for visual context.
    • model (str): Model identifier (e.g., claude-3-5-sonnet-20241022).
    • temperature (float): Sampling temperature to control response randomness.
    • max_tokens (int): Maximum number of tokens in the response.
    • timeout (int, optional): Time (in seconds) before the request times out.
    • max_retry (int): Maximum number of retries for failed requests.
    • json_mode (bool): Whether to parse the response as JSON.
  • Returns: Response as a string or dictionary.

call_llm_async

Asynchronous version of call_llm, supporting the same parameters and functionality.

Running the Examples

  1. Navigate to the examples folder:

    cd examples
    
  2. Ensure you have created and populated the .env file as described above.

  3. Run the synchronous and asynchronous examples:

    python example_usage.py
